企业用的什么数据库
-
企业使用的数据库有很多种,根据不同的需求和业务场景,企业可以选择不同类型的数据库来存储和管理数据。以下是几种常见的企业使用的数据库:
-
关系型数据库(RDBMS):关系型数据库是最常见和广泛使用的数据库类型。它们使用表格来组织和存储数据,并使用结构化查询语言(SQL)来管理和操作数据。常见的关系型数据库包括Oracle、MySQL、Microsoft SQL Server等。关系型数据库适用于大部分企业的数据管理需求,尤其适合需要高度结构化数据和复杂查询的场景。
-
非关系型数据库(NoSQL):非关系型数据库是一类不使用SQL语言的数据库,它们以不同的方式存储和组织数据,如键值对、文档、列族等。非关系型数据库适用于需要处理大量非结构化或半结构化数据的场景,如社交媒体数据、日志数据等。常见的非关系型数据库包括MongoDB、Cassandra、Redis等。
-
内存数据库:内存数据库将数据存储在内存中,而不是磁盘上。这使得数据的读写速度更快,适用于对响应速度要求非常高的应用场景,如金融交易系统、实时数据分析等。常见的内存数据库包括SAP HANA、Redis等。
-
列存储数据库:列存储数据库将数据按列存储,而不是按行存储。这种存储方式在处理大规模数据和分析查询时效率更高,适用于需要进行复杂分析和报表生成的场景,如数据仓库、商业智能系统等。常见的列存储数据库包括Vertica、Greenplum等。
-
图数据库:图数据库是专门用于存储和处理图形数据(节点和边)的数据库。它们适用于需要进行复杂图形分析和关系挖掘的场景,如社交网络分析、推荐系统等。常见的图数据库包括Neo4j、Amazon Neptune等。
总结起来,企业使用的数据库类型多种多样,根据具体的需求和业务场景选择合适的数据库是至关重要的。不同类型的数据库各有优势和特点,企业可以根据自身需求来选择适合的数据库来存储和管理数据。
1年前 -
-
企业在选择数据库时,通常会根据自身的需求和特点来进行选择。以下是一些常见的企业使用的数据库类型:
-
关系型数据库(RDBMS):关系型数据库是企业最常用的数据库类型,它使用表格和行列的方式来存储数据,并且支持SQL语言进行数据操作。常见的关系型数据库包括Oracle、MySQL、Microsoft SQL Server和IBM DB2等。
-
NoSQL数据库:NoSQL数据库是指非关系型数据库,它采用键值对、文档、列族等不同的数据模型来存储数据,具有高可扩展性和高性能的特点。常见的NoSQL数据库有MongoDB、Cassandra、Redis和Elasticsearch等。
-
数据仓库:数据仓库是用于存储和管理大量结构化和非结构化数据的专门数据库系统,它通常用于支持企业决策和分析。常见的数据仓库包括Teradata、Snowflake和Amazon Redshift等。
-
图数据库:图数据库是一种专门用于存储和处理图结构数据的数据库,它适用于复杂的关系和网络分析。常见的图数据库有Neo4j和Amazon Neptune等。
-
内存数据库:内存数据库是将数据存储在内存中的数据库系统,它具有极高的读写性能和低延迟的特点,适用于对实时性要求较高的应用场景。常见的内存数据库有SAP HANA和MemSQL等。
除了以上几种类型的数据库,还有一些特定领域或特定用途的数据库,例如时序数据库(用于存储时间序列数据)、空间数据库(用于存储地理空间数据)和文本数据库(用于存储大量文本数据)等。
企业在选择数据库时,需要根据自身的业务需求、数据规模、性能要求和预算等因素来进行评估和选择。同时,考虑到数据库的可靠性、安全性、可扩展性和易用性等方面的要求也是非常重要的。最终的选择应该是综合考虑各种因素后得出的最佳方案。
1年前 -
-
企业使用的数据库主要有以下几种:
-
关系型数据库(RDBMS):关系型数据库是最常见的数据库类型,它使用表格的形式来存储和组织数据。常见的关系型数据库包括MySQL、Oracle、Microsoft SQL Server和PostgreSQL等。企业使用关系型数据库的原因是它们具有强大的事务处理能力和数据完整性保证。
-
非关系型数据库(NoSQL):非关系型数据库是一种不使用表格的数据库类型,它通常使用键值对、文档、列族或图形等方式来存储数据。非关系型数据库具有高可扩展性和灵活性,适用于存储大量结构化和非结构化数据。常见的非关系型数据库包括MongoDB、Cassandra和Redis等。
-
数据仓库:数据仓库是一种专门用于存储和分析大规模数据的数据库。它通常用于支持企业的决策和分析需求,具有高性能和扩展性。常见的数据仓库包括Teradata、Amazon Redshift和Google BigQuery等。
-
内存数据库:内存数据库是将数据存储在内存中的数据库,具有高速读写和低延迟的特点。它适用于需要快速处理大量数据的场景,例如实时分析和高并发事务处理。常见的内存数据库包括SAP HANA、MemSQL和VoltDB等。
-
图数据库:图数据库是一种专门用于存储和处理图形数据的数据库。它适用于处理复杂的关系和网络数据,例如社交网络分析和推荐系统。常见的图数据库包括Neo4j、Amazon Neptune和Microsoft Azure Cosmos DB等。
-
时序数据库:时序数据库是一种专门用于存储和处理时间序列数据的数据库。它适用于存储和分析具有时间维度的数据,例如传感器数据和日志数据。常见的时序数据库包括InfluxDB、Prometheus和KairosDB等。
企业在选择数据库时,通常会根据具体的需求和业务场景来进行评估和选择。一般来说,关系型数据库适用于事务处理和数据一致性要求较高的场景,非关系型数据库适用于大规模数据存储和高可扩展性要求较高的场景,数据仓库适用于数据分析和决策支持场景,而内存数据库、图数据库和时序数据库则适用于特定的数据处理需求。
1年前 -